sim: Fix 32-bit module build
Specify -mcmodel=large only on 64-bit case. (x86-64)
The code model is not available for 32-bit.
This fixes the following error:
MODULECC: chardev.c
cc1: error: code model 'large' not supported in the 32 bit mode
Makefile:79: recipe for target 'chardev.o' failed
